- CHECK DLC3
-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in RESULT REFERENCE .
Result
RESULT REFERENCETester connection Condition Specified value Result D4-6 (CANH) - D4-14 (CANL) - IG switch OFF
- Stop light switch OFF
108 to 132 ohms A D4-6 (CANH) - D4-14 (CANL) - IG switch OFF
- Stop light switch OFF
132 ohms or higher B NOTE: When the measured value is 132 or more and a CAN communication system diagnostic code is output, there may be a fault other than a disconnection of the DLC3 sub bus line. For that reason, troubleshooting should be performed again from "How to Proceed with Troubleshooting" after repairing the trouble area.
B: REPAIR OR REPLACE DLC3 BRANCH LINE OR CONNECTOR (CAN-H, CAN-L)
A: Go to next step

- CHECK CAN MAIN BUS LINE FOR DISCONNECTION (ECM - CAN J/C)
- Disconnect the connector (E7) from the ECM.
-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in TESTER CONNECTION SPECIFIED CONDITION .
Standard resistance
TESTER CONNECTION SPECIFIED CONDITIONTester Connection Condition Specified Condition E7-33 (CANH) - E7-34 (CANL) - IG switch OFF
- Stop light switch OFF
108 to 132 ohms

OK: REPLACE ECM
NG: Go to next step
- INSPECT CAN J/C
- Disconnect the CAN main bus line connector (J10) from the CAN J/C.

NOTE:- Before disconnecting the connector, make a note of where it is connected.
- Reconnect the connector to its original position.
- Measure the resistance according to the value in CONNECTOR TERMINAL RESISTANCE SPECIFICATION .
Standard resistance
CONNECTOR TERMINAL RESISTANCE SPECIFICATIONBetween the terminals where the connector (J10) was connected Condition Specified value CANH - CANL - IG switch OFF
- Stop light switch OFF
108 to 132 ohms
NG: REPLACE CAN J/C
OK: REPAIR OR REPLACE CAN MAIN BUS LINE OR CONNECTOR (CAN J/C - ECM)
